温州地区二维闪电定位系统与三维闪电定位系统的探测效率和探测精度分析

利用温州地区二维、三维闪电定位系统监测数据和电力设备受雷电影响断电数据,统计分析了两套闪电定位系统的探测效率和探测精度,以及二维闪电系统历年探测效率评估.结果表明:三维闪电定位系统的探测效率和探测精度均高于二维闪电定位系统,二维闪电定位系统未因投入运行时间变长影响探测效率.
Analysis of Detection Efficiency and Accuracy of Two-Dimensional Lightning Location System and Three-Dimensional Lightning Location System in Wenzhou Area
Using the monitoring data from the two-dimensional and three-dimensional lightning location systems in Wenzhou area,as well as the outage data of power equipment affected by lightning,this paper statistically analyzes the detection efficiency and accuracy of the two systems,as well as the evaluation of the detection efficiency of the two-dimensional lightning system over the years.The results show that the detection efficiency and accuracy of the three-dimensional lightning location system are both higher than that of the two-dimensional system.Additionally,the detection efficiency of the two-dimensional system has not been affected by the increasing length of its operational time.
